Play an important role as a volunteer at Copenhagen Sprint. The first World Tour cycling race in Denmark for both men and women.
We are looking for route volunteers to be stationed along the course, which stretches from Roskilde, north to Hillerød, and finishes in Copenhagen.
In addition, we need dedicated sector leaders who will be responsible for coordinating and supporting their own group of route volunteers within a specific section of the course.
As a sector leader, you’ll play a key role in the event and be responsible for ensuring that the route volunteers in your sector are well briefed and feel confident in their tasks. The role of a route volunteer is to guide participants, raise a few barriers, keep an eye on the road closure, and inform road users about the expected duration. You will not be directing traffic.
In the places where traffic is to be regulated, there will be traffic trained people, just as Race Marshalls will continuously pass by the individual posts. In other words, you should NOT regulate traffic.
